MDS

Sad reality of value. Eagles completley overvalue the defensive line. See contracts for Kearse and Howard, now Thomas, and first round picks on the likes of Simon, McDougle, Bunkley and Patterson.

They couldn't care less about wide out. One (late) first rounder, Frederick Mitchell, and one marginal big money signing (big name, but underpaid given production) in Owens. Otherwise, we know...Charles Johnson, Torrence Small, Todd Pinkston, Greg Lewis, Antonio Freeman, Wilbur, James Thrash. It looks like they've finally hit on Reggie Brown.
